Celebrate You: You vs. You

Last week we talked about you saying negative things about yourself, this week we're going to talk about you standing in your way. Think about this. You're running a race and you hear a voice telling you "you're not gonna make it" "what are you doing here?" "Just quit before you embarass yourself." Then you look and see it's only you and the track. The person saying these things to you, was you. The only person trying discourage you is you.

If you have a dream, go for it. Don't let you stand in your way. Yes, people may tell you no or may say negative things about you but you know you can do it. Let them tell you no, don't tell you no. You never know what you can do until you try. Don't be a slave to fear. The bible says in Romans 8: 15: For you did not receive a spirit that makes you a slave again to fear, but you received the Spirit of sonship.[a] And by him we cry, "Abba,[b] Father." When God adopted us, he took away that spirit of fear. That spirit comes from the devil. God wants you to know that you can do all things through him. God gave us his spirit. He is full of confidence, wisdom, and promise. God knows the things he has for us. God can do all things and we have that spirit. We should be full of confidence. We are the children of he who created the world. Don't be afraid and don't tell you no. Get out of your way and let God work.
